Choosing the correct domain name can mean the difference between online success and failure

Thomas Darré Medard Frederiksen, chief operating officer at One.com, said the correct domain name for a company about to undertake in birmingham web design can help broaden a company's reach on the web if they are well selected.

The domain name needs to be be simple, memorable and relevant to the business.

"When combined with interesting content and a solid service or product it can be a winning formula," he stated.

"Consider all the options, take into account current offerings as well as future plans and select a domain name that will [deliver]."

There are at present 22 generic top level domain names duch as .co.uk and .com, for companies to choose from when setting up a website. But with the Internet Corporation for Assigned Names and Numbers welcoming generic top level domain name applications up until April 12th, companies will soon have a wider range of choices for their web address suffix.
